Subject: [PATCH 1/3] media: radio-wl1273: Avoid card name truncation

The "card" string only holds 31 characters (and the terminating NUL).
In order to avoid truncation, use a shorter card description instead of
the current result, "Texas Instruments Wl1273 FM Rad".
Suggested-by: Hans Verkuil <hverkuil@xs4all.nl>
Fixes: 87d1a50ce451 ("[media] V4L2: WL1273 FM Radio: TI WL1273 FM radio driver")
Signed-off-by: Kees Cook <keescook@chromium.org>
---
drivers/media/radio/radio-wl1273.c |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/drivers/media/radio/radio-wl1273.c b/drivers/media/radio/radio-wl1273.c
index 112376873167..484046471c03 100644
--- a/drivers/media/radio/radio-wl1273.c
+++ b/drivers/media/radio/radio-wl1273.c
@@ -1279,7 +1279,7 @@ static int wl1273_fm_vidioc_querycap(struct file *file, void *priv,
strscpy(capability->driver, WL1273_FM_DRIVER_NAME,
sizeof(capability->driver));
- strscpy(capability->card, "Texas Instruments Wl1273 FM Radio",
+ strscpy(capability->card, "TI Wl1273 FM Radio",
sizeof(capability->card));
strscpy(capability->bus_info, radio->bus_type,
sizeof(capability->bus_info));
